What should a reference letter contain?

Elbert Donatelli: The institution you have requested the letter from should be using a form letter. You can look up free legal forms on the internet and get a standard reference letter form. You know the kind where you fill in the blanks. Good luck.

Troy Staton: Your strengths, contributions, abilities, competence for the program, and your scholarly ability. At least that is what I would write for this "particular educational program," you are applying for.Since when does a graduate program ask for a reference from a university president? Most come from professors, academic advisers, mentors, perhaps the Dean of your program, but not the president.As in the case of your old job, the person writing it lacked written communication skills or didn't know how to write a reference letter....Show more
